A 100 g particle moving with initial speed u strikes a second, identical 100 g particle that is initially at rest. If the total kinetic energy of the system after the collision is 0.2 J, what are the minimum and maximum possible values of u?
- min = 2 m/s, max = 2*sqrt(2) m/s
- min = 1 m/s, max = 2 m/s
- min = 2*sqrt(2) m/s, max = 4 m/s
- min = sqrt(2) m/s, max = 2 m/s
Correct answer: min = 2 m/s, max = 2*sqrt(2) m/s
Solution
For a fixed final KE of 0.2 J, the smallest u corresponds to no energy loss (elastic), and the largest u corresponds to maximum energy loss (perfectly inelastic).
